
How to Make a Rainbow
Ryan Maxey
Ryan Maxey’s film, which took home the Outfest Los Angeles Audience Award for Best Short Documentary, followed Jade Phoenix Martinez and her daughter Alaizah over the course of two formative years, as they journeyed through the joy and struggle of a parent in transition.

Take Me to Prom
Andrew Moir
LGBTQIA+ Canadians ranging in age from 17 to 88 reflect on their experience with the adolescent ritual of prom, and how they managed to put their own queer spin on it. Andrew Moir’s inspiring short doc played in over 20 film festivals, capturing hearts and awards along the way.

The Orphan
Carolina Markowicz
Winner of the Queer Palm at the Cannes Film Festival, Carolina Markowicz’s film follows a young boy in São Paulo who finds his flamboyance may drive a wedge between him ad his adoptive parents.
